Pure alcohol mass in a serving can be calculated if concentration, density and volume are known. For example, a 350 ml glass of beer with an ABV of 5.5% contains 19.25 ml of pure alcohol, which has a density of 0.78945 g/mL (at 20 °C), and therefore a mass of 15.20 grams.
